A significant traffic collision occurred today on State Route 55 North near Paularino Avenue in Costa Mesa, CA, causing major disruptions during the afternoon commute. The incident involved three vehicles and resulted in the blockage of the middle lanes, with two to three lanes partially closed. This led to considerable traffic congestion and delays for motorists traveling through the area.
Emergency response teams, including multiple traffic management units, were dispatched to the scene to manage the situation and facilitate the clearing of the vehicles involved. A tow truck was called to assist in removing the vehicles from the roadway. As responders worked to clear the scene, traffic flow was severely impacted, leading to backups extending in both directions.
Motorists are advised to seek alternative routes to avoid delays as the cleanup continues. The California Highway Patrol is actively managing traffic control to ensure safety and expedite the reopening of the affected lanes.
